The average hourly wage for Event Planners in Virginia Beach is approximately $28 per hour. However, earnings for Event Planners can vary considerably depending on the venue, event size and specific responsibilities they undertake.

The Impact of Restaurant Type on Event Planner Earnings in Virginia Beach

The restaurant’s concept and event hosting capability directly influence the earning potential of Event Planners. More upscale, full-service venues tend to offer higher base pay and larger bonuses linked to successful, high-budget events.

On the other hand, casual or quick-service restaurants may offer fewer opportunities for event planning or smaller-scale functions, resulting in lower overall compensation for planners.

Other factors impacting earnings include:

  • Event Size and Complexity: Larger, multi-day events or those requiring elaborate coordination often pay more.
  • Location: Venues close to Virginia Beach’s tourist hubs or beachfront attract affluent clients with more generous event budgets.
  • Certifications and Experience: Certified Event Planners or those with proven experience commanding higher salaries.
  • Time of Year: Peak seasons such as summer and holidays can provide increased hourly rates or bonuses.

How To Find a High Paying Event Planner Job in Virginia Beach

Research Local Venues Actively Hiring

Monitor restaurants and event spaces known for large or luxury gatherings. Targeting venues with active hiring increases chances of landing roles with better pay.

Gain and Showcase Relevant Certifications

Credentials such as the CMP (Certified Meeting Professional) or CSEP (Certified Special Events Professional) set you apart and justify higher salary requests.

Network within the Local Hospitality Community

Attend Virginia Beach industry mixers, engage with hospitality groups or connect with hiring managers on LinkedIn for insider opportunities.

Prepare a Tailored Resume and Cover Letter

Highlight Event Planning experience, venue types and success stories relevant to Virginia Beach clients and restaurant settings.

Practice Interview Scenarios

Be ready to discuss how you would handle specific event challenges, budgeting, vendor relations and guest satisfaction concerns.

Is an Event Planner’s Salary Enough to Live Well in Virginia Beach?

Event Planners in Virginia Beach typically earn between $50,000 and $60,000 annually based on average hourly wages and bonuses. This income provides a comfortable foundation in an area where living costs are relatively moderate.

Here’s a brief overview of typical monthly expenses for a single adult in Virginia Beach:

  • 1-Bedroom Apartment Rent (City Center): around $1,200
  • Utilities (electricity, gas, water): approximately $150
  • Transportation (car or public transit): $100–$150
  • Groceries and Household Supplies: around $300

Given these figures, earning a solid Event Planner salary in Virginia Beach can support a comfortable lifestyle including housing, dining and entertainment. With steady work, planning professionals can also save or invest toward future goals.
